What type of education and previous experience does the potential youngster care provider have? Many professionals consider caretaker education and training to be among the most critical areas for making sure and improving the high quality of day care.


The number of children will each caregiver look after and the amount of youngsters will be in the team? Fewer children per caretaker and smaller team dimensions are very important due to the fact that youngsters obtain even more individual attention and caregivers can be extra responsive to each youngster's needs. The child care licensing and accreditation laws define the optimum variety of youngsters who might be looked after in a group and they likewise define the number of caretakers required for a group of kids.


When children are between ages 3 and 4 years, the Group Childcare Facility licensing regulations enable 10 children per caregiver without even more than 20 youngsters in a group. Exactly how can I examine to ensure that this service provider is fulfilling the licensing/certification policies? All accredited and certified programs get regular surveillance check outs. Each time a keeping track of browse through is carried out, the licensing/certification expert checks to make certain compliance with chosen licensing/certification policies. At the end of every monitoring check out, the licensing/certification professional discusses any type of infractions or interest in the licensee/certified operator and a report of the findings is issued.


These reports identifying the results of keeping track of sees for both qualified and public school operated childcare programs are presented on the public childcare search web site. In accredited programs, the reports also need to be posted near the license in an area that is readily visible to moms and dads and the general public.
